You know that sinking feeling when you're watching your food cost climb past 35% and there's still six hours left on the clock. Red Lobster's endless shrimp disaster is every operator's nightmare writ large — a promotion that sounds brilliant until you realize you've just invited people to eat your margins into the ground. The real lesson isn't about bankruptcy or corporate restructuring. It's simpler: know your break-even on every plate, or someone else will be writing your obituary.
